Netaji Nagar Day College, established in 1986 in Kolkata, West Bengal, is a prominent institution affiliated with the University of Calcutta. It offers diverse undergraduate programs across Arts, Science, and Commerce, fostering academic excellence and a vibrant campus environment for holistic student development.

Must-Visit Tourist Spots
Victoria Memorial Hall
10 km
Iconic marble monument dedicated to Queen Victoria, a blend of British and Mughal architecture.
Howrah Bridge
15 km
Cantilever bridge over the Hooghly River, a symbol of Kolkata.
Indian Museum
10 km
The oldest and largest multi-purpose museum in the Asia-Pacific region.
Dakshineswar Kali Temple
25 km
Historic Hindu temple situated on the eastern bank of the Hooghly River.
Kalighat Kali Temple
6 km
One of the 51 Shakti Peethas, a very significant Hindu pilgrimage site.
Science City
12 km
A large science center and amusement park, popular for educational entertainment.
Alipore Zoological Garden
8 km
India's oldest formally stated zoological park.
Prinsep Ghat
12 km
A historical ghat on the banks of the Hooghly River, known for its scenic beauty.
Mother House
10 km
The headquarters of the Missionaries of Charity, founded by Mother Teresa.
Eco Park
25 km
An expansive urban park with themed zones, offering diverse recreational activities.
Weekend Getaways
Digha
180 km
Popular sea beach destination in West Bengal, known for its flat, hard beach.
Shantiniketan
160 km
A university town established by Rabindranath Tagore, known for its cultural and educational heritage.
Bishnupur
140 km
Famous for its terracotta temples and historical significance of the Malla dynasty.
Mayapur
120 km
Global headquarters of ISKCON, a major pilgrimage site with a grand temple complex.
Sundarbans
110 km to Godkhali (gateway)
World's largest mangrove forest and a UNESCO World Heritage Site, home to Royal Bengal Tigers.
Mandarmani
170 km
A tranquil sea beach destination, known for its long motorable beach.
Bakkhali
130 km
A charming beach resort on the Bay of Bengal coast, accessible via ferry.
Gadiara
100 km
A riverside picnic spot and tourist destination at the confluence of Rupnarayan, Damodar, and Hooghly rivers.
